Variety traits
Baking quality is a complex of wheat grain characteristics that determine its ability to form dough with specific physical properties for producing bread of high volume and porosity.

Baking quality reflects the ability of the grain's protein complex to create an elastic and resilient dough structure upon hydration. Based on this trait, wheat is categorized into strong, which acts as an improver for weaker flour; medium, which serves as the standard for mass production; and weak, which has limited suitability for baking.
Evaluation of baking quality is based on a system of physical, biochemical, and technological indicators, including protein and gluten content, gluten deformation index (GDI), test weight, vitreousness, and falling number. Rheological analysis methods using instruments that measure dough stability and deformation work are also employed.
The final grain quality depends on the combination of variety genetics and environmental conditions. The stability and maintenance of high baking properties are ensured by the proper choice of variety, adherence to agronomic practices, including nitrogen fertilization levels and sowing dates, as well as timely harvesting and high-quality storage of the crop.
